From: Do transgenesis and marker-assisted backcross breeding produce substantially equivalent plants? - A comparative study of transgenic and backcross rice carrying bacterial blight resistant gene Xa21

Figure 1

Bacterial blight resistance spectrum analysis of D62B, DXT and DXB. Nine Xoo strains from Philippine (P1-P10) were used to innoculate the rice leaves in the high tillering stage. The shorter the yellow portion on a leaf is, the higher plant resistance to Xoo infection. DXT: transgenic line with Xa21; DXB: MAB line with Xa21; D62B: the common parental line of DXT and DXB.
